Summary
This course blends accounting and business finance theory to solve operational problems faced by managers. It provides you with a comprehensive knowledge of the key areas, preparing you for a career in management where an accounting and finance focus is required. You benefit from invaluable opportunities for collaboration and growth with leading organisations in the field, and your studies bring theory and practice together, applying both to situations where vital financial decisions are made.
Facilities and specialist equipment - Cutting-edge business suite with industry-standard technology, uniquely tailored to essential management, finance and data practices
-
Up-to-date financial databases and statistical software such as FAME, Eikon, Stata and SPSS
-
Access to learning resources and immersive simulations from Harvard Business Publishing
-
Reuters trading room supplying worldwide ‘stock-market’ data for a realistic investment experience
-
Business pods, boardroom areas and IT suites designed to simulate a professional office environment
Industry links Benefit from our links with accountancy’s ‘big four’: Ernst & Young; KPMG; PwC; and Deloitte as well as professional bodies such as the Institute of Chartered Accountants in England and Wales, who invite students to their networking events and visit the University as conference speakers.
Your student experience Learn from our highly qualified academics, whose active industry involvement directly shapes the course and ensures you stay on top of the latest developments in the field.
Our business and management courses rank 4th overall in their subject field in the Postgraduate Taught Experience Survey 2024, with top 3 rankings for teaching, engagement, learning community and course organisation.
Our practice-led curriculum makes use of case studies, simulations and industry collaborations, preparing you for the world of work.
Learn to analyse and interpret complex data with hands-on tasks grounded in real-world statistics.
Get involved in real-life accounting and business problems with the University’s Research and Innovation Service (RIS), where you can assist businesses, from start-ups to established corporations, to up-skill and innovate.
Develop key vocational skills, from critical evaluation and advanced problem solving to independent learning and strategic leadership.
Enrich your student experience with industry masterclasses and our Global Guest Speaker series, featuring high-profile academics, industry experts and business leaders.
Take part in field trips to major financial locations including the Bank of England.
Our annual conference provides further avenues for work experience, contact building and specialist skill acquisition.
Shape the course to your interests and career ambitions with your choice of Master’s capstone dissertation; professional placement; internship; or live project.

Summary
This course is integrative, blending accounting and business finance theory to solve problems faced by managers on a daily basis.
You will also further develop the necessary quantitative, research, and presentation skills required for successful career in business or further academic study.
Your studies will be enhanced by the integration of theory and practice into those situations where vital financial decisions have to be made.
There are six entry points throughout the year. This allows you to start at a time that is suitable for you. Please refer to our website for details.
Why choose this course? - Study in formal lectures, seminars and tutorials but also in small groups that involve the in-depth discussion of case studies, simulation exercises, preparation for assessments and work on presentations
-
Explore the synthesis of information from different sources, and take different contextual approaches from a range of perspectives in order to solve complex problems and implement solutions
-
Develop your skills in the use of REUTERS 3000 Eikon, which will equip you with technical knowledge and skills in trading and data analysis
-
Gain a deep understanding of the synthesis of information from different sources and of the international context of your subject
-
Benefit from teaching that focuses on the relevance of accounting regulations to a complex globalised economy.
